5. choose healthy jelly pay attention to matters 1. choose low sugar, low calorie products: in order to reduce sugar intake, choose low sugar, low calorie jelly products more healthy.

2. Try to choose natural ingredients: Avoid buying jelly products that contain too many food additives, and it is healthier to choose jelly with natural ingredients.

3. Pay attention to intake: Although jelly has certain nutritional value and health effects, because it contains sugar, excessive intake may lead to obesity and other problems, so it is necessary to pay attention to moderate consumption.
